Форум 1С
Программистам, бухгалтерам, администраторам, пользователям
Задай вопрос - получи решение проблемы
22 ноя 2024, 01:24

Данные из справочника подставить в тч документа

Автор Varan, 01 окт 2015, 18:34

0 Пользователей и 1 гость просматривают эту тему.

Varan

Попробовал создать свою конфигурацию и возник вопрос : как организовать автоматическое заполнение табличной части  документа "Приход" при выборе ИнвентарногоНомера из справочника " Склад".


дфтын

Смотрите реакцию на событие в табличной части - ПриИзменении

Varan

Цитата: дфтын от 01 окт 2015, 18:41
Смотрите реакцию на событие в табличной части - ПриИзменении
Если я правильно понял, то вызвать создать событие ПриИзменении у элемента формы "ИнвентарныйНомер" и вписать что-то похожее на это :


&НаКлиенте
Процедура ДанныеПриходИнвентарныйНомерПриИзменении(Элемент)
СтрТЧ = Элементы.ДанныеПриход.ТекущиеДанные;
СтрТЧ.НазваниеТовара = 
СтрТЧ.Количество =
СтрТЧ.ЕдиницаИзмерения =
СтрТЧ.ЦенаЗаЕденицуТовара =
КонецПроцедуры


если так, то что после " =  " писать ? Извините, полный чайник  :dfbsdfbsdf:

дфтын

Ну тут зависит от того,а что вы собственно делаете?
количество , наверное 1?
единица измерения.. ну инвентарный номер. это не номенклатура.
может вам выбирать номенклатуру? и из неё брать единицу измерения..

Varan

Цитата: дфтын от 01 окт 2015, 20:46
Ну тут зависит от того,а что вы собственно делаете?
количество , наверное 1?
единица измерения.. ну инвентарный номер. это не номенклатура.
может вам выбирать номенклатуру? и из неё брать единицу измерения..
Ну-с, в тч справочника хранятся все данные о товаре:


И при подставленные в документе инв. номера заполняются все поля :


cska-fanat-kz

ваще жесть! :wacko:

1. какой смысл в тч в справочнике Склады? текущее "содержимое" склада? обычно для этого применяется регистр накопления.
2. цена и единица измерения - это свойства товара и должна "сидеть" в справочнике товары. хотя цены конечно тоже обычно отдельно хранят в регистре сведений.
3. обычно склад - это реквизит ШАПКИ документа "Приход", т.е. обычно склад в документе один (если конечно обратного не требуется бизнес-логикой)
4. заполнение тч документа по остаткам на складе делается по кнопке (обычно "Заполнить") или реализуется подбор.
Получил помощь - скажи СПАСИБО.
Разобрался сам - расскажи другим.

Похожие темы (5)

Рейтинг@Mail.ru

Поиск